When a new Colonel from Earth-3 threatens to tarnish the good name of everyone's favorite chicken chef, it's up to Colonel Sanders and The Flash to set things right!

For being a comic length KFC ad, this was actually one of the one of the funniest things I've read in a while. And the premiss makes sense, if there's an opposite Superman, there's an opposite you, and an opposite Colonel, right? I always like seeing Green Lantern, but not sure what his role in the story was, except maybe to give Flash another outsider to talk to so he wouldn't be talking to himself or directly to the audience. He could have been omitted and nothing would be lost.
